Understanding Material Grades in IBR Pipe Fittings

Selecting the appropriate material type for your IBR (Indian Boiler Regulations) tubing fittings is essential for guaranteeing safety and performance. IBR specifies defined material requirements to handle the extreme pressures and temperatures commonly found in boiler systems. The most frequently used materials include various grades of carbon steel, such as IS 2062 Grade A, B, and C, each representing a varying level of tensile strength, yield point, and ductility. Stainless steel, like 304L or 316L, are also employed when corrosion resistance is crucial. Understanding the chemical composition and mechanical properties of each material grade allows engineers and technicians to choose informed decisions regarding fitting selection, preventing potential failures. Considerations should include the operational pressure, fluid type, and temperature range to ensure sustained serviceability.

  • Review relevant IBR codes and standards.
  • Assess the specific application requirements.
  • Contrast material properties against operational conditions.

IBR Pipe Fitting Standards and Certifications Explained

Ensuring the reliability of industrial boiler systems copyrights on using pipe fittings that meet strict IBR (Indian Boiler Regulations) specifications . These codes mandate specific design, material, and manufacturing processes for fittings used in pressure vessels and boilers. Multiple certifications, like the IBR Certificate of Approval, demonstrate a manufacturer’s compliance with these guidelines . Achieving this certification involves rigorous testing procedures encompassing hydrostatic tests, non-destructive examination (NDE) techniques – such as radiography or ultrasonic inspection – and thorough documentation. Correct adherence to these IBR fitting norms guarantees operational functionality and minimizes the potential for catastrophic failures within boiler installations. The specific grade of material, often designated by its chemical composition and mechanical properties, must also align with approved IBR schedules .

Common Mistakes to Avoid When Using IBR Pipe Fittings

Successfully utilizing IBR pipe joints requires attention to detail, and several common errors can compromise their integrity. Often , installers skip proper surface preparation , leading to inadequate weld quality or degradation. Another frequent setback arises from using the incorrect diameter of fitting for the specified task ; always verify compatibility before installation . Besides, improperly securing bolted connections can result in leaks, while bending or stressing fittings beyond their design limits will undoubtedly lead to failure . Finally, failing to correctly brace the piping system itself introduces unnecessary stress and contributes to premature wear .
